Output 668300daf823bf8d652c290675b08a2fdab7311d04f77fd96cc9a90234857c53:0

value
51800127465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1dd9d2367c8e6dd58c8d3de8f77bbdace73e49a OP_EQUAL
address
3GStCRhie2yy3PfGfvnLQNB7wgE5H4zeo4
transaction
668300daf823bf8d652c290675b08a2fdab7311d04f77fd96cc9a90234857c53
spent
true